Place the sugar in a medium bowl and slowly stir in the milk and vanilla, a little at a time, to make a smooth, pourable glaze. #stayhomestaysafe #mrandmrsyoutuber Try this simple and quick icing sugar glaze for cake this is a great substitute for cream frosting. Powdered sugar glaze is a basic icing used to glaze donuts or to coat or drizzle over many other desserts such as bundt cakes, quick breads, cookies, and scones. The addition of liquid glucose give a shiny finish to the cookies. And use sifted icing sugar as any lump in the sugar will make it very hard to pipe using the tiniest nozzle.
